Data Center Engineer - Oklahoma City, United States - PAYCOM PAYROLL LLC
Description
Primary point of contact for Data Center technologies and related mechanical devices. Participates in projects to design and implement mechanical and electrical improvements to data centers. Develops procedures to outline data center processes, and related tasks. Participates and leads in the design and engineering data center technologies and future datacenter related initiatives. Mentors Data Center Operations team members and helps increase their effectiveness and skillset. Serves as a Level I escalation point for Data Center monitoring team to address critical/complex Data Center related issues. Key contributor and driver of important, challenging and high-visibility team projects.RESPONSIBILITIES
Acts as Subject Matter Expert and first level support for the operation and maintenance of the Data Center, technologies
Helps lead small projects assigned to Data Center Team
Participates in projects related to data center design, construction and certifications
Participates in projects related to data center design and architecture
Participates in projects related to data center construction and design to achieve Uptime Institute Data Center Tier levels
Participates in opportunities for improvement and architecture changes
Develops and implements strategies to ensure proper power, cooling and other capacity needs
Implements strategies to ensure proper power, cooling and other capacity needs of the Data Center to ensure availability

Knowledge of:
Datacenter HVAC, CRAC, CRAH cooling technologies
Datacenter power, UPS, generator operations, etc
Datacenter fire suppression systems (FM200, HFC125, etc)
General knowledge of datacenter design and construction
LAN/WAN
Emerging Technology Trends
Datacenter Best Practice and Industry Standard Methodology
